If you’ve ever thought, “Building a mobile app sounds complicated and time-consuming,” you’re not alone. Many developers and businesses feel stuck between the need for functional apps and the challenges of traditional coding. That’s where FlutterFlow IO comes in. This online, low-code visual builder takes the heavy lifting out of app development, letting you focus on bringing your ideas to life.
What is FlutterFlow IO?
FlutterFlow IO is an intuitive platform for creating native mobile applications without writing extensive code. The platform shines with its drag-and-drop interface, making it easy for users to design and adjust app elements visually. Built-in features like live preview let you see changes as you make them, reducing the trial-and-error phase. Its seamless backend integration with services like Firebase and easy connection to APIs ensures a smoother workflow for developers and non-developers alike. Built on Google’s Flutter framework, it lets developers visually design, prototype, and deploy apps faster than ever. Whether you’re a beginner or a seasoned developer, this tool simplifies the process without compromising on quality.
Here’s what sets it apart:
- Drag-and-drop interface: Build app screens visually, eliminating the need for manual coding.
- Backend integration: Connect your app to Firebase, APIs, or other databases with ease.
- Cross-platform compatibility: Design apps for iOS and Android simultaneously.
- Live preview: See changes in real-time and test your app as you build.
Why Developers and Businesses Love FlutterFlow
Developers and entrepreneurs often juggle tight deadlines and limited resources. For instance, consider a small startup that needed an app to present at a funding pitch but couldn’t afford a big development team. By turning to FlutterFlow, they built a fully functioning prototype within days, impressing investors and securing the funding they needed. FlutterFlow provides a solution that saves time, money, and headaches. Here’s why it’s catching on:
Speeds Up Prototyping:
- Traditional app development can take months. For example, a small nonprofit wanted to launch an app to help connect volunteers with local projects. Using FlutterFlow, they built a functional prototype within three days. This quick turnaround allowed them to secure critical stakeholder approvals and move to the next development phase without delays.
- This rapid iteration makes it easier to test ideas and get stakeholder buy-in early.
Lowers the Barrier to Entry:
- Coding experience isn’t mandatory. If you can use a design tool, you can build with FlutterFlow.
- Perfect for small businesses or startups without dedicated development teams.
Integrations Galore:
- Seamlessly connect your app to services like Firebase, REST APIs, and Stripe.
- These integrations make your app functional right out of the box.
Cost-Efficiency:
- Hiring developers can be expensive. With FlutterFlow, a single license goes a long way.
- Plus, fewer bugs and quicker updates mean long-term savings.
How FlutterFlow Simplifies the Development Process
Think of FlutterFlow as a Swiss Army knife for app development. Instead of juggling multiple tools, you get everything you need in one place. Here’s how it helps:
1. Drag-and-Drop Builder
No coding knowledge? No problem. Use the drag-and-drop editor to design beautiful interfaces. Add buttons, images, forms, and animations in minutes.
2. Code Export
Need customizations? Export the Flutter code anytime and hand it off to a developer. You’re not locked into the platform, which gives you flexibility.
3. Responsive Design
FlutterFlow ensures your app looks great on any device. The platform automatically adjusts layouts for different screen sizes, saving you time and effort.
4. Interactive Components
Create interactive features like:
- Login forms
- Search bars
- Dynamic lists
These are essential for modern apps and are easy to implement in FlutterFlow.
Real-Life Example: A Startup’s Journey
Take Sarah, a small business owner who wanted to create an app for her online store. Before finding FlutterFlow, she juggled with the idea of hiring a developer, which didn’t fit her limited budget, and tried learning to code herself, which quickly became overwhelming. She felt stuck until she stumbled across FlutterFlow.
This platform simplified her project and gave her the confidence to build the app she’d envisioned, all while managing her daily tasks as a business owner. She didn’t have a background in coding but knew she needed an affordable solution. Using FlutterFlow, she built her app in three weeks. The drag-and-drop editor made design simple, while Firebase integration helped her manage inventory and customer data.
Fast forward six months, and Sarah’s app is live on both Android and iOS, reaching more customers than ever.
Key Features
Here’s a closer look at what you’ll get:
- Visual Editor: Skip the code and focus on design.
- Custom Widgets: Import or create unique widgets for your app.
- Animations: Add polished transitions and effects to enhance user experience.
- Preview and Testing: Test your app directly in the builder before publishing.
- Deployment Options: Publish directly to the Google Play Store or Apple App Store.
Tips for Getting Started with FlutterFlow
If you’re new to the platform, these tips will set you up for success:
- Start small: Build a basic prototype first. This helps you learn the platform while creating something functional.
- Use templates: FlutterFlow offers pre-designed templates to speed things up.
- Explore tutorials: Their website and community forums have step-by-step guides.
- Test frequently: Use the live preview feature to catch errors early.
FAQs
Q: Do I need coding experience to use FlutterFlow?
A: Nope! While coding knowledge can help with advanced features, the drag-and-drop builder is perfect for beginners.
Q: Can I export my app’s code?
A: Yes, you can export the Flutter code and modify it as needed. This is great for customizations or handing it off to developers.
Q: Is FlutterFlow only for mobile apps?
A: Primarily, yes. But since it’s based on Flutter, you can adapt your project for web and desktop platforms too.
Q: How much does FlutterFlow cost?
A: They offer different pricing tiers, starting with a free plan. Check their website for the latest details.
Q: Does FlutterFlow support app analytics?
A: Absolutely. You can integrate services like Firebase Analytics to track user behavior.
Why FlutterFlow is Worth Exploring
If you’ve ever struggled with app development, FlutterFlow can be a breath of fresh air. It simplifies the process, saves time, and lets you focus on creativity. Whether you’re a solo entrepreneur or part of a team, this platform levels the playing field.
From drag-and-drop tools to seamless integrations, FlutterFlow IO makes app development accessible. Try it out—you might be surprised by how much you can achieve.
Final Thoughts
FlutterFlow IO is revolutionizing the way apps are built. By combining user-friendly design tools and seamless integrations, it makes building apps approachable for everyone. Features like a drag-and-drop editor and real-time previews remove common barriers, making the creative process smoother and more enjoyable. If you’re ready to create without the coding headaches, FlutterFlow IO is your go-to tool.